Two Strong Signals.

Tamil Nadu Chief Minister M Karunanidhi's birthday celebrations in Chennai yesterday has sent out two clear-cut signals. Of course, the UPA made it a point to use it as an opportunity to display and reiterate its 'strong' unity, in the backdrop of BJP's victory in Karnataka. Sonia personally chose Pranab Mukherjee to represent her in the DMK patriarch's birthday Conference.

WELCOME, BUT DIDN'T TURN UP
The conspicuous absentee at the otherwise grand celebrations was the PMK founder Dr. Ramadoss. Though his party leaders including his Minister-son was personally there to greet the octogenarian leader, Ramadoss did not deem it necessary to call on the DMK Chief. A couple of days back, Ramadoss had in a statement demanded probe into Jayalalitha's allegation about the unchecked flow of foreign funds. "It is a serious allegation which has to be enquired into", he insisted.

TURNED UP, BUT UNWELCOME
Another signal that the birthday celebrations gave out in unambiguous terms is that the Maran brothers, Dayanidhi and Kalanidhi are not welcome back into the family's fold. Mu Ka Azhagiri did succeed in preventing his father from meeting the media-baron and the former Union Minister. To convey their greetings, they waited nearly an hour in the drawing room of the CM's house in CIT Nagar, only to be told that their grand-pa had no time to meet them. And, one of them is still a sitting MP of the party! That is a rude confirmation of the estrangement.
